The second city of the future scenario is titled Green Spaces. The mayor of Green Spaces City is interviewed on November 10, 2052, to facilitate an understanding of life in Green Spaces. The mayor discusses the trends, reasons, and disruptive forces that led Green Spaces to be designed as a city for people. Next, she shares the feel of the city, how did the city evolve to what it has become, and how the compromise and tradeoffs between humanity and the environment continue to shape the multi-generational life of the citizens in Green Spaces.
